Database Management

SQL (Structured Query Language) is the standard language used for accessing and manipulating databases. It allows developers to create, modify, manage, and migrate databases effectively. The development, management, and migration of SQL databases are crucial for maintaining dsecata integrity and optimizing performance in various applications.

SQL Database Projects

SQL database projects serve as a local representation of SQL objects that make up the schema of a database. This includes tables, stored procedures, functions, and more. The development cycle integrates with continuous integration and continuous deployment (CI/CD) workflows, making it a best practice for teams looking to streamline their database development processes. Each object in a SQL project is defined once, allowing for easy modifications and updates through a .dacpac file that can be published to target databases.

Key Features

Declarative T-SQL Statements

Projects are based on T-SQL statements that define database objects.

Validation

Relationships between objects are validated during the build process to ensure consistency and correctness.

Deployment

The build artifact can be deployed to new or existing databases, facilitating reliable updates.

SQL Database Management

Effective management of SQL databases involves various tools and practices aimed at ensuring optimal performance and security.

Key Tools for SQL Database Management

We utilize a variety of advanced tools designed to streamline database management processes:

Oracle SQL Developer

A robust tool that supports various database management tasks including migrations, automation, and performance tracking. Its user-friendly interface simplifies complex database operations.

dbForge Studio

Known for its powerful capabilities in database development and administration, dbForge Studio helps improve performance and productivity through features like visual table design, T-SQL editing, and server event monitoring.

Azure Data Studio

This lightweight, cross-platform tool enhances productivity with features like on-demand SQL query execution, data editing, and an intuitive interface for managing database connections. It's particularly useful for users who work across different operating systems.

Microsoft SQL Server Management Studio (SSMS)

A comprehensive integrated environment that allows for the management of SQL Server instances and databases. SSMS provides a rich set of features for querying, designing, and monitoring databases, making it a go-to tool for database administrators.

Best Practices for Management

  • Regular Performance Monitoring: We continuously monitor database performance using built-in tools to identify bottlenecks and optimize query execution times.

  • Data Security Protocols: Implementing strict access controls and encryption measures protects sensitive data from unauthorized access.

  • Backup and Recovery Plans: Regular backups are scheduled to safeguard data integrity. We also have recovery strategies in place to minimize downtime in case of failures.

  • Automated Maintenance Tasks: Routine tasks such as index rebuilding and statistics updates are automated to maintain optimal performance without manual intervention.

SQL Database Migration

Database migration is the process of transferring data between storage types, formats, or systems. This is often necessary when upgrading systems or moving to cloud-based solutions.

Migration Strategies

  • Data Migration Assistant (DMA): This tool helps assess compatibility issues prior to migration, allowing us to address potential problems early in the process.

  • ETL Processes: For complex migrations involving data transformation, we utilize Extract, Transform, Load (ETL) processes to ensure data integrity across different platforms.

  • Testing and Validation: Post-migration testing is critical. We validate the migrated data against the source to confirm accuracy and completeness before going live.

Services

  • Application Development & Design

  • Website Design

  • Mobile Development

  • eCommerce

  • Artificial Intelligence

  • Blockchain

  • SEO

Information

  • Home

  • About Us

  • International Partnership

  • Healthcare Solutions

  • Career

  • Contact Us

US Office

  • 1510 Primewest Parkway Katy, TX 77479

India Office

  • B-164, Lower Ground Floor

    Amar Colony,

    Lajpat Nagar - IV,

    New Delhi-110024, INDIA

© 2018-2024 Solarius Solutions | All rights reserved